What is Back Ablation Surgery?
Back ablation surgery is a minimally invasive procedure used to treat chronic back pain. Unlike more extensive spinal surgeries, ablation targets specific nerves causing pain, using heat or radiofrequency energy to deactivate them. This procedure is often considered for patients who haven't found relief through conservative treatments like physical therapy or medication. Bryant's Recent Struggles and the Road to Surgery
Bryant, a three-time All-Star and 2016 NL MVP, has been battling back issues for a considerable period. His performance this season has been hampered by persistent discomfort, significantly impacting his batting average and overall effectiveness on the field. The Rockies' medical team explored various non-surgical options before concluding that ablation surgery offered the best chance for long-term pain relief and a return to peak performance.
